跟著互聯網技巧的壹直開展,前端開辟在用戶休會跟交互方面扮演著越來越重要的角色。Vue.js作為一個風行的前端JavaScript框架,以其簡潔的API跟高效的呼應式體系遭到了眾多開辟者的愛好。Element Plus,作為Vue.js的UI組件庫,供給了豐富的組件,可能幫助開辟者疾速構建現代化的用戶界面。本文將探究怎樣控制Vue.js跟Element Plus,從而晉升前端開辟效力。
Vue.js簡介
Vue.js是一個漸進式JavaScript框架,它容許開辟者以申明式的方法構建用戶界面,並實現高效的視圖更新。Vue.js的核心特點包含:
- 呼應式數據綁定:經由過程Vue.js的數據綁定機制,開辟者可能輕鬆地實現數據與視圖之間的同步更新。
- 組件化開辟:Vue.js鼓勵開辟者將界面剖析為可復用的組件,進步了代碼的可保護性跟可讀性。
- 機動的指令:Vue.js供給了一系列內置指令,如
v-if
、v-for
、v-bind
等,使開辟者可能以更簡潔的方法實現複雜的功能。
Element Plus簡介
Element Plus是基於Vue.js 3.x的UI組件庫,它供給了豐富的組件,包含但不限於:
- 基本組件:如按鈕、輸入框、抉擇器等。
- 規劃組件:如柵格體系、規劃容器等。
- 表單組件:如表單、表單驗證等。
- 數據展示:如表格、分頁、圖表等。
Element Plus的特點包含:
- 基於Vue.js 3.x:與Vue.js 3.x無縫集成,充分利用其新特點跟機能優化。
- 簡潔易用:組件計劃遵守Material Design標準,界面簡潔美不雅。
- 高度可定製:支撐主題定製,滿意差別項目標特性化須要。
疾速上手Vue.js跟Element Plus
1. 安裝Vue.js
起首,須要在項目中安裝Vue.js。可能經由過程以下命令安裝:
npm install vue@next
或許
yarn add vue@next
2. 安裝Element Plus
接著,安裝Element Plus:
npm install element-plus --save
或許
yarn add element-plus --save
3. 引入Element Plus
在項目標進口文件(如main.js
)中引入Element Plus:
import { createApp } from 'vue'
import ElementPlus from 'element-plus'
import 'element-plus/dist/index.css'
const app = createApp(App)
app.use(ElementPlus)
app.mount('#app')
4. 利用Element Plus組件
現在,可能在Vue組件中利用Element Plus組件了。以下是一個簡單的例子:
<template>
<el-button type="primary">點擊我</el-button>
</template>
<script>
import { ElButton } from 'element-plus'
export default {
components: {
ElButton
}
}
</script>
晉升開辟效力的技能
- 組件化開辟:將界面剖析為獨破的組件,進步代碼的可保護性跟可復用性。
- 按需載入:利用Vue.js的非同步組件跟Webpack的代碼分割功能,實現組件的按需載入,增加初始載入時光。
- 利用Element Plus的文檔跟示例:Element Plus供給了豐富的文檔跟示例,可能幫助開辟者疾速上手跟處理成績。
- 持續進修跟現實:前端技巧更新敏捷,持續進修跟現實是晉升開辟效力的關鍵。
經由過程控制Vue.js跟Element Plus,開辟者可能構建高效、美不雅的前端利用,晉升開辟效力。